Molson Pace Preview Friday May 31st at Western Fair Raceway

1-Foiled Again (7-5)  Yannick Gingras/Ron Burke 2-Aracache Hanover (6-1) Douglas McNair/Gregg McNair 3-State Treasurer (4-1) Randall Waples/Dr Ian Moore 4-Versado (7-1) Scott Zeron/Nicholas Surick 5-Rock On Moe (12-1) Brad Forward/Patrick Shepherd 6-Keystone Velocity (8-1) Trevor Henry/Frank Kamine 7-A Rocknroll Dance (10-1) John Campbell/James Mullinix 8-Betterthancheddar (8-5) George Brennan/Casie Coleman

The big question in my mind is whether Betterthancheddar is ready to roll off that qualifier where he won by over 9 lengths. A Rocknrolldance came back from a similarly impressive qualifier and didn't fire in the Maturity and Dan Patch. The 8 post isn't the best one to make a comeback from, but he does like this track, so I'll put him on top.

Foiled Again is pure class, even if he is looking a little tired lately. In case he suddenly wakes up and remembers how good he is, I'll play him on top and underneath in exotics also.

Rock On Moe has good early speed and will probably be the front runner. Whether he can hold that place is debatable. He hasn't been running at stakes level, but his trainer can move his horses up in class pretty well. He has the home court advantage with 7 out of 10 wins at Western Fair. I'm going to include him in exotics.

State Treasurer ran a very good race from a tough post last time out and I think he may do a lot better from the 3 post, so he'll be in my exacta and trifecta.

A Rocknrolldance has had two tough races and was hung out for most of the last one. I'd like him a lot better if he was in a better post position, but you can't count him out.

Arache Hanover might be the sleeper in this one. The word is that he choked last time out when he had to be throttled back sharply. If that's the case, he may run a much better race this time and can close as well as leave, which is a dangerous combination.

My picks are the 1/8-3-5.
